Arm’s Length have announced an upcoming headline tour in support of their newest album, There’s A Whole World Out There out now via Pure Noise Records. Dates will span 25 cities and kick off on April 21 in Ottawa, ON at Bronson Centre. Support comes from The Callous Daoboys, Harrison Gordon and label mates Super Sometimes. Tickets go on sale this Friday, December 12 at 10am local time.

Arm’s Length recently completed a nationwide run of shows supporting Hot Mulligan on The Sound A Body Makes When It’s Still Tour. Ahead of their North American headliner, they will tour the UK and Europe with Ben Quad.
